Why SoftwareWorld Chooses ChartMeds
"Long-term care facilities and assisted living communities often turn to ChartMods because medication management can be difficult to handle accurately with paper-based systems. Staff can track resident medications more consistently, which helps reduce errors during daily rounds. It works well for smaller care settings that need a straightforward way to stay organized. That said, larger healthcare organizations with complex clinical workflows may find the platform limited in scope over time."

ChartMeds Pros & Cons
Consider the practical advantages and limitations identified through SoftwareWorld's product assessment.
Pros
- Cloud-based setup means no bulky hardware installations required
- Medication pass documentation becomes noticeably faster for nursing staff
- eMAR system reduces paper charts and manual transcription errors significantly
- Built specifically for assisted living facilities, not adapted from hospital software
- Audit-ready records help facilities stay compliant during state inspections
- Real-time alerts notify staff about missed or late medication passes
- Pharmacy integration keeps resident medication lists current without duplicate data entry
Cons
- Reporting depth falls short for analytics-driven long-term care teams
- Mobile experience feels noticeably limited compared to the desktop version
- Onboarding new staff takes more structured effort than initially expected
- Pricing visibility requires direct contact rather than transparent online tiers
